The Advantages Of Using A Brick Incinerator For Waste Disposal

When it comes to waste disposal, finding an efficient and environmentally friendly solution is crucial. One option that is gaining popularity is the use of a brick incinerator. A brick incinerator is a specially designed structure used for burning waste materials at high temperatures. This process not only helps in reducing the volume of waste but also has various other advantages. In this article, we will discuss the benefits of using a brick incinerator for waste disposal.

One of the primary advantages of a brick incinerator is its efficiency in disposing of waste. Unlike traditional methods of waste disposal, such as landfills or open burning, a brick incinerator can burn waste at much higher temperatures. This high temperature helps in breaking down organic materials and reducing them to ash, which takes up significantly less space than the original waste. As a result, a brick incinerator can help in reducing the volume of waste that needs to be disposed of in landfills, ultimately saving valuable landfill space.

Another advantage of using a brick incinerator is that it can help in reducing the environmental impact of waste disposal. When waste is burned in a brick incinerator, it is done at high temperatures, which helps in minimizing the release of harmful gases and pollutants into the atmosphere. In addition, the ash produced after burning can be used as a valuable resource, such as a construction material or fertilizer, rather than being discarded as waste. This not only reduces the amount of waste that needs to be disposed of but also minimizes the environmental footprint of waste disposal.

Furthermore, using a brick incinerator can help in reducing the risk of disease transmission. Improper disposal of waste can lead to the spread of diseases and contamination of water sources. By burning waste in a controlled environment, a brick incinerator can effectively eliminate pathogens and bacteria that may be present in the waste. This can help in creating a safer and healthier environment for communities that rely on proper waste disposal practices.

In addition to its efficiency and environmental benefits, a brick incinerator is also a cost-effective solution for waste disposal. While the initial construction of a brick incinerator may require some investment, the long-term savings in waste disposal costs can outweigh the initial expense. By reducing the volume of waste that needs to be transported to landfills, a brick incinerator can help in saving on transportation and landfill fees. Moreover, the ash produced after burning can be reused or sold, providing an additional source of revenue.

Another advantage of using a brick incinerator for waste disposal is its versatility. brick incinerators come in various sizes and configurations, making them suitable for different types of waste and different scales of operation. Whether it is for a small community, a commercial facility, or an industrial plant, there is a brick incinerator that can meet the specific waste disposal needs. This flexibility makes a brick incinerator a practical solution for a wide range of waste management scenarios.
